Joan Reminick reviews Ahuva’s Grill in Hewlett, which is highly recommended “whether you observe the Jewish laws of kashrut or simply view life as one giant flavor quest. …Here, chef-owner Ahuva Tsadok ignites and soothes the palate with a compelling repertoire of Yemenite Israeli dishes.”
Peter Gianotti visits Schafer’s in Port Jefferson, a “buoyant, water-view perch” that takes over the space that used to house The Catch and Dockside, among other eateries.
